Frequently Asked Questions about bed and breakfast in Thailand

  • What are the most visited cities in Thailand?

    Bangkok is the most popular destination, a vibrant metropolis with countless temples, bustling markets, and a thriving nightlife. Chiang Mai in northern Thailand offers a different experience, with its rich cultural heritage, stunning mountain scenery, and numerous temples. Phuket, a major island in the south, is renowned for its beautiful beaches and vibrant tourism scene. Pattaya, another coastal city, is known for its beaches and entertainment. These four consistently rank among the most visited.

  • Which are the most commonly used airports for traveling to Thailand?

    Suvarnabhumi Airport (BKK) in Bangkok is the main international gateway, handling the vast majority of international flights. Don Mueang International Airport (DMK), also in Bangkok, serves as a significant hub for budget airlines and domestic flights. Other airports like Phuket International Airport (HKT) and Chiang Mai International Airport (CNX) are important for regional and international connections to their respective areas.

  • What is the currency in Thailand, and can I easily withdraw cash from ATMs?

    The currency is the Thai baht (THB). Yes, withdrawing cash from ATMs is very easy and widely available, even in smaller towns and villages. Most ATMs accept international debit and credit cards.

  • How advisable is it to drive in Thailand?

    Driving in Thailand can be challenging for visitors. Traffic can be heavy, especially in cities, and the driving style may differ from what you're used to. Road signs may not always be clear in English. Consider using ride-hailing apps, taxis, or public transportation for easier travel, especially in urban areas. Renting a car with a driver is a popular option for longer trips outside of cities.

  • What are the key cultural norms to know before traveling to Thailand?

    Thailand is a country with deep-rooted traditions. It's considered polite to remove your shoes before entering temples and some homes. Showing respect for the monarchy is important. Public displays of affection are generally frowned upon. The 'wai,' a traditional greeting, is a respectful gesture. Dress modestly when visiting temples. Learning a few basic Thai phrases will be appreciated.

  • What are the most celebrated events in Thailand?

    Songkran, the Thai New Year water festival in April, is a nationwide celebration. Loy Krathong, a festival of lights held in November, sees people releasing floating lanterns on waterways. Many temples hold significant festivals throughout the year, often with colorful processions and ceremonies. Check local listings for specific dates and events in your travel area.

  • What should you do if you lose key documents in Thailand?

    Immediately report the loss to the nearest police station and obtain a police report. This document will be crucial for replacing your passport and other travel documents through your embassy or consulate. Contact your embassy or consulate for assistance with replacing your documents. Make copies of your passport and other important documents before your trip and store them separately from the originals.
  • Which area of Thailand is ideal for enjoying good weather?

    The best time to visit for good weather varies by region. The central and southern regions generally experience warm temperatures year-round, with the dry season (November to April) typically being the most pleasant. Northern Thailand has a more distinct wet and dry season, with the dry season offering the best weather.
